Understanding the Exchange Process
Ethereum and Binance Coin operate on distinct blockchain networks․ Ethereum utilizes its own robust network, while BNB is the native cryptocurrency of the Binance Chain and Binance Smart Chain (BSC)․ Therefore, converting ETH to BNB involves bridging these two ecosystems․ This typically occurs through centralized exchanges or decentralized platforms that facilitate cross-chain interoperability․
Methods for Converting ETH to BNB
Centralized Exchanges:
Platforms like Binance, Coinbase, and Kraken offer straightforward ways to convert ETH to BNB․ The process usually involves depositing your ETH into your exchange account, trading it for BNB directly on the platform, and then withdrawing the BNB to your preferred wallet․ These exchanges often provide user-friendly interfaces and competitive exchange rates․
Decentralized Exchanges (DEXs) and Aggregators:
For those seeking a more decentralized approach, DEXs and cross-chain aggregators present an attractive option․ Platforms such as GhostSwap, Uniswap (with appropriate bridging), and various other aggregators allow users to swap ETH for BNB directly from their non-custodial wallets (like MetaMask)․ These services often emphasize speed, minimal fees, and no KYC (Know Your Customer) requirements, offering a more private trading experience․
Bridging Solutions:
In some instances, you might need to use a blockchain bridge to move your ETH from the Ethereum network to the Binance Smart Chain before you can directly swap it for BNB on a BSC-based DEX․ These bridges act as intermediaries, locking your ETH on one chain and issuing a wrapped version on another, which can then be traded․
Key Considerations for Conversion
- Exchange Rates: The conversion rate between ETH and BNB fluctuates based on market demand and supply․ It’s advisable to compare rates across different platforms before executing a trade․
- Fees: Be aware of transaction fees, network fees (gas fees on Ethereum), and any platform-specific trading fees․ These can impact the overall cost of your conversion․
- Network Compatibility: Ensure you are sending and receiving tokens on the correct networks․ For example, if you are swapping ETH for BNB on the Binance Smart Chain, you’ll need to ensure your ETH is bridged to BSC or that the platform handles the cross-chain transfer seamlessly․
- Wallet Security: When using decentralized platforms or managing your own private keys, maintaining strong wallet security is paramount․
- Speed: Transaction speeds can vary depending on network congestion and the platform used․
